The Magicshine SEEMEE DV Camera Taillight is a cutting-edge bicycle rear light that combines safety and technology. With 1080P recording capabilities, a 146° wide-angle lens, and a robust 3400mAh battery offering up to 110 hours of runtime, this taillight ensures you capture every detail of your ride. Its IPX6 waterproof rating and durable aluminum construction make it perfect for urban cyclists, while smart features like automatic loop recording and app connectivity enhance your cycling experience.

Easy setup and works great
This light feels really high quality right out of the box. I was worried that the included strap and mount wouldn't fit on my aero seat tube, but it did without issue. Setup with the included app was really easy following the instructions: follow the QR, download the app, connect via wifi, and that was it (I'm using an Iphone, so I can't speak to android setup). I did have to restart the light after pairing with the phone so it came out of "abnormal" mode with the white ring around the camera, but then everything functioned as normal. On the road, this has performed exactly as expected and hasn't missed any vehicles coming up from behind. It's even more helpful than I had expected to be able to trust the SeeMee and let it do its job. Occasionally, it will pick up an oncoming large truck or other vehicle after it passes and alarm as if it's an approaching vehicle, but it's pretty rare and I would rather it was on the sensitive side than have it miss cars coming from behind! As a light, it is certainly bright enough and has the usual low and high brightness, as well as two flashing modes. I really like that it casts light to the sides, which shines off your legs when it's darker out and makes you look even bigger/brighter. The SeeMee DV has worked perfectly since setup and the price was great compared to other options. Would definitely recommend to anyone considering it!

Will record an accident and that is good enough for me.
I like the simplicity of the light/camera. Just turn it on like any other bike tail light and it starts recording video as well. The video quality is good enough to get information if I am ever in an accident or hit by a driver. Easiest way to transfer video is to remove the sd card and download video. No need to use the app. I don't use the app at all. For some, the cruddy app is a dealbreaker. I like not needing the app, this adds to the DV's simplicity. I doubt the video quality would be high enough if you want to post rides on YouTube or something like that. But the quality is more than good enough to identify someone or to use in evidence if you ever needed to sue or prosecute following an accident.The light works great and seems to be bright enough.I do wish that the light came with the saddle mount as well as the seat post mount. It seems like they cheaped out here forcing you tobuy another accessory for different mounting options.

good but flawed
I like this as a tail light. it does give you a camera option to see behind you, but there is one big caveat as to why i do not use it as I intended/expected. You cannot use the camera and still use any sort of internet on your phone. If your place was to use this as a central rear view mirror on your handlebar, then I hope you also do not want to stream a podcast or music. It uses wifi as a connection when it should use bluetooth. I was hoping to remove my mirror from my bars to simplify things to a phone holder and light holder, but alas.I do still like it, and it does give peace of mind knowing that it is recording in case something happens. Then the footage can be recovered, or be used for yourself.Battery life is amazing. This can record and be a lighted tail light all week for my use case, an 11.6 mile commute, and still has charge after 5 rides back and forth.Mounting is iffy. I use a second elastic around it to secure it. Something this expensive on a mini garmin mount felt an extra rubber tie, or a clip to secure elsewhere should have been included. maybe even a ring you can improvise the rest on your own. I just hot glued on a ring the back to use with the elastic to make sure things stay on.also on the mounting it would have been nice to have something that would work to mount on a basket or tail bag as I would see this more useful to commuters who likely have a rear bag/basket which would block the seat post.

Deceptive picture
The light and camera both work as described. However, the picture on my phone screen is deceiving. I thought seeing what was behind me would provide some reassurance. However, the picture actually heightens my anxiety. I live in the US (traffic on the right). A car comes up behind me, and instead of seeming to steer over to the left of the road on my phone, it appears to steer to the right, seemingly about to hit me. With a mirror, the car passing on my left would appear on the left side of the image. With this camera, the car appears on the right side of the image. Deceiving, and a little scary. I don’t know why they can’t put a setting to flip the image.Also annoying is about a one second lag between reality and the picture. The car has passed me, but still appears on the screen. Almost makes you think that there are two cars.Probably going to return it. It’s s shame, because otherwise the product has a lot to offer.
